The passing of Liam Payne has brought to light important discussions surrounding inheritance and estate distribution in the British legal system. Following the unfortunate news of the One Direction star's death, it's revealed that he died intestate, meaning without a will. This scenario raises significant considerations for his nine-year-old son, who stands to inherit a substantial fortune valued at approximately $29 million.
Understanding Intestacy Laws in the UK
When a person dies without a will in the UK, their estate is distributed according to intestacy rules, which are designed to determine how assets are shared among surviving relatives. In this case, Liam Payne's estate will be allocated primarily to his child, given that he had no spouse or registered partner at the time of his passing.
The Implications for Liam's Son
- Financial Security: With a sizable estate to inherit, Liam's son is ensured a financial future that many children can only dream of.
- Legal Guardianship: As a minor, the management of this inheritance will likely be placed under the supervision of a guardian or trustee until he reaches adulthood.
- Emotional Support: The inheritance comes with the burden of loss; it's crucial for the young boy to receive adequate emotional support during this time.

Lessons for Future Planning
- Draft a Will: It is essential for everyone, especially those with considerable assets and dependents, to create a will to ensure their wishes are honored.
- Consider Guardianship: Parents should think about who will take care of their children and manage their assets in their absence.
- Communicate Wishes: Open discussions with family members about estate planning can prevent misunderstandings and ensure a smoother transition for loved ones.
